Opinions in for sale threads?
I'm interested in other people's thoughts on this, Given we have a specific "For Sale/Classifieds" section and a regional forum, I've always believed that this (the general forum) is for opinions, and the classified forum is for buying and selling.
I've noticed a few for sale threads have ended up with people's opinions of the product being sold which is annoying for the seller and takes the thread off topic. Unless the product is illegal, unsafe, or blatantly doesn't/won't/can't do what the seller is claiming then unless you are either interested in the product or have a genuine question about condition, why not keep the opinions here in the regular forum? I know this is the internet and all, but classifieds is classifieds not "Please give me your opinion of what I have for sale". I have really mixed feelings on this. Obviously I wouldn't want someone de-railing my for sale thread, but at the same time as a purchaser I like to be informed.
Let's take an example, as a buyer you find someone selling some wheels for $2k that you like. Someone else posts in the thread a link to an online shop that sells them for $1500 new, would you want to know that? Or another example, a for sale thread for a part that's known to reduce power (eg certain intakes/headers)? The onus is on the buyer to know what they are buying of course, "buyer beware" and all that, but it's still a forum which should be an open place to have a discussion to everyone's mutual benefit. Hard to say where to draw the line! |
